Gabriella Massa: The Electrifying Voice of Canadian Pop-Rock
Gabriella Massa is a dynamic pop-rock singer-songwriter from Toronto, Canada, who has carved a distinct niche with her powerful vocals and guitar-driven anthems. Her major-label debut album, 'Catalyst,' cracked the Top 20 on the Canadian Albums Chart and spawned a certified Gold single, establishing her as a formidable force in the modern rock scene.
Early career
Born in 1994, Massa began her musical journey in her early teens, honing her craft on acoustic guitar while drawing inspiration from both classic rock radio and contemporary pop-punk. After several years of performing in local Toronto venues, she independently released her first EP, 'Static Echoes,' in 2015, which caught the attention of A&R scouts and led to a publishing deal.
Breakthrough
Gabriella Massa's breakthrough arrived in 2018 with the release of her single "Frayed Ends," which became a staple on Canadian alternative rock radio. The song's success paved the way for her debut album, 'Catalyst,' released the following year on NorthSound Records, which debuted at number 18 on the national chart and earned her a nomination for Breakthrough Artist at the Juno Awards.
Key tracks
Frayed Ends — This certified Gold single served as her mainstream introduction, dominating rock airplay for months and defining her signature blend of melodic hooks and gritty guitar.
Catalyst — The title track from her debut album showcases her songwriting depth, building from a subdued verse into a massive, anthemic chorus that became a fan favorite at live shows.
Paper Crowns — A notable collaboration with veteran producer David Bottrill, this track highlighted a more atmospheric and textured side of her sound, expanding her artistic range.
Better Ghosts — Released as the lead single for her sophomore effort, this song marked a evolution towards a more polished, arena-ready rock sound with prominent synth layers.
Following the success of 'Catalyst,' Massa spent two years touring extensively before returning to the studio. Her 2022 follow-up, 'Neon Heart,' debuted in the Top 30 and featured a notable co-write with fellow Canadian artist Tyler Shaw on the track "Echo Location." She has consistently maintained a strong presence on rock radio formats with each new release.
